For those of you who thinks "our" government wouldn't lie to take us to war, you should do a little reading about a little thing called the Gulf of Tonkin Incident. Reason for War Sec. of Defense McNamara later admitted the second attack never happened. But yet, that was used as the impetus for our involvement in Vietnam. Poor judgement or straight up lies?
